Probability is useful to quantify uncertainty and describe random events and outcomes. We'll cover ways of calculating probabilities using formulas along with Python functions, how to visualize these random outcomes on a distribution, and how to represent a population using sample data.
Probability allow us to measure uncertainty. This is essential in many different industries, such as meteorology, medicine, sports, insurance, and countless more.
We need to know how:
Define probability using the law of large numbers
Quantify uncertain events using:
The addition rule
The product rule
Bayes' Theorem
Tree Diagrams
Describe random events using probability distributions
Understand use-cases for the following probability distributions:
Binomial Distribution
Poisson Distribution
Describe a population using a sampling distribution and the central limit theorem
